body, form, p { margin:0; padding:0; }
body { background:#494949; color:#000; font-family: Verdana, Geneva, sans-serif; font-size: 12px; }

a { font-size:12px; color:#0099cc; }
table { font-size: 12px; }
img { border: 0; }

p  { font-size:12px; display:block; padding: 0.5em 0; }
p a { font-size:12px;  color:#0099cc; }
p a:hover { font-size:12px;  color:#666; }
p strong, b  { font-weight: bold; display: inline; }

hr { height:1px; color:#a7a093; margin-bottom:10px; }

h1{ font-size:24px; font-weight:normal; color:#99cc00; }
h2{ font-size:24px; font-weight:normal; color:#99cc00; padding-left: 0px; }
h3{ font-size:24px; font-weight:normal; color:#99cc00; padding-left: 0px; }

.nc_text  h4 { font-size: 14px; font-weight: bold; margin: 0 0 0.25em 0; padding: 0; }

table.bott{ background: url(img/bott.jpg) top left repeat-x; color:#FFF; display: inline-table; }
table.bott a { color:#FFF; text-decoraton: none; }

.top_menu { width: 100%; font-size:70%; z-index:1; height:43px; display: block; }
.top_menu a { display: block; float: left; margin: 0 2px; padding: 13px 0 0 0; width:118px; height:43px; background: url(img/arr1.gif) top left no-repeat; font-size:15px; text-decoration: none; color:#000; text-align:left; }
.top_menu a:hover { display: block; float: left; padding: 13px 0 0 0; width:118px; height:43px; background: url(img/arr2.gif) top left no-repeat; font-size:15px; text-decoration: none; color:#fff; text-align:left; }

.mmm { padding-left: 33px; }

.nc_value input { width:97%; }
.nc_value textarea { width:97%; }

.nc_news h2{ font-size:18px; font-weight:normal; color:#333; padding:0px;}
.nc_full_text{ font-size:12px;}
.nc_price{ font-size:18px; font-weight:normal; color:#333;}

tr.nc_row nc_a { font-size:12px; padding-top:15px; vertical-align:top; border-bottom:#999 1px dashed; }
tr.nc_row h3{ font-size:18px; font-weight:normal; color:#333; padding:0px; }
tr.nc_row nc_b { font-size:12px; padding-top:15px; vertical-align:top; border-bottom:#999 1px dashed; }

td.qwer { font-size:11px; padding-right:15px; }
td.qwer a { font-size:11px;color:#d57003; }
td.qwer a:hover { font-size:11px;color:#000; }
td.center { vertical-align:top; }
td.center1 { background: #fff; font-size:14px; vertical-align:top; }
td.center a { font-size:12px;  color:#0099cc; }
td.center2 { background: #fff; font-size:14px; vertical-align:top; }
td.topleft { font-size:14px; color:#2f2e26; }
td.topleft a { font-size:14px; color:#2f2e26; }
td.topleft a:hover { font-size:14px; color:#FFF; }
td.topright { font-size:14px; color:#2f2e26; }
td.topright h1 { font-size:24px; display:inline; font-weight:normal; margin-top:5px; line-height:50px; white-space:nowrap; }
td.imenu { padding-right:5%; padding-left:5%; height:45px; vertical-align:middle; }
td.icenter { padding-right:80px; padding-left:90px; vertical-align:top; padding-top:55px; font-size:12px; }
td.icenter h1 { font-size:34px; font-weight:normal; color:#85a3ba; }
td.footer1 { padding-right:80px; padding-left:90px; font-size:12px; background:url(img/footer1.jpg) top center no-repeat;}
td.copyr, a { font-size:11px; color:#5a7383;}

div.bott_menu { font-size:70%; z-index:1; height:13px; display: inline-table; }
.bmmm { padding: 0 25px 0 0; }
.bott_menu a { background:none; font-size:11px; display: inline;  color:#CCC; white-space:nowrap; text-decoration: none; }
.bott_menu a:hover { background:none; font-size:11px; display:inline;  color:#000; white-space:nowrap; text-decoration: none; }

a.mainmenu{ background:url(/img/arr.gif) top left no-repeat; font-size:14px; color:#0099cc; padding-left:20px; display:block; padding-bottom:10px; white-space:nowrap;}
a.mainmenu:hover{ background:url(/img/arr1.gif) top left no-repeat; font-size:14px; color:#0099cc; padding-left:20px; display:block; padding-bottom:10px; text-decoration:none; white-space:nowrap;}
 
.auth{ background:url(/img/auth.gif) top left no-repeat; width:26; height:21px; border:none;}
 
#quickBarMainSection b,a { display: inline; }


